Clink Street is an atmospheric narrow cobbled street that runs parallel to the River Thames from the Anchor Tavern to Southwark Cathedral. On the south side are the remains of Winchester Palace with the wonderful rose window and opposite are some very handsome renovated Victorian warehouses.
Borough Market is London's most renowned food market; a source of exceptional British and international produce. Since its renaissance as a retail market just over a decade ago, it has become a haven for anybody who cares about the quality and provenance of the food they eat - chefs, restaurateurs, passionate amateur cooks and people who just happen to love eating and drinking.

The area provides a wealth of restaurants, pubs and shops, and comes alive with market stalls every week between Thursday and Saturday. The River Thames is a short walk away, as is Tate Modern. The London Bridge area is in the heart of the capital and is directly accessible from all major transport gateways.

London Bridge station - major terminus from South East England, including the ports of Dover, Ramsgate and Folkestone.

Thameslink/First Capital Connect services from London Bridge station link directly with Kings Cross and Blackfriars stations and many areas to the north of London to Bedford and to the south to Brighton.

London Underground:

Northern Line (London Bridge & Monument) - direct link to Kings Cross, St Pancras (Eurostar International Station) and Euston stations and to all other Underground lines.

Jubilee Line (London Bridge) - the modern extension provides direct links to Waterloo station, the Docklands (including Canary Wharf), Stratford (London Olympics site) in the east end and Bond Street in the west end
